Vegetarian Sausage Rolls

These are delicious and nutritious! My kids had no idea they contained no meat!

Ready In: 40 mins

Serves: 32

Yields: 32 rolls

Directions

  1. In food processor, finely chop onion and pecans. Add eggs,sauce,breadcrumbs, carrot and cottage cheese. Process.
  2. Place mixture in a large bowl and add oats.
  3. Cut each sheet of pastry in half. Brush all edges with milk. Put mixture in a sausage shape lengthways down each half sheet of pastry. Roll up into long sausage shapes. Mark each sausage into four with flat side of a knife. Don't cut through as filling doesn't set til cooked. Brush tops with milk. Cook in a moderately hot oven til brown and crispy. Serve with ketchup.
  4. They can be frozen and reheated individually as needed. Great for those nights you want to feed the kids quickly! Makes between 32 and 40 rolls depending on whether you add carrot or more vegetables.
